RPG Maker Unite Delayed

Gotcha Gotcha Games have announced that their upcoming game engine RPG Maker Unite has been delayed. The engine was meant to release first via Unity Asset Store on April 6, but have now delayed it to an unannounced date.

The company noted this was done in order to “further improve the product’s quality and stability.”

While no date is revealed, Steam still lists it releasing some time this year.
